The MC68376BGCAB25 is a powerful 32-bit microcontroller integrated circuit (IC) produced by NXP USA Inc., part of the M683xx series. Designed for complex embedded system applications requiring high processing performance, robust connectivity, and versatile integration, the MC68376BGCAB25 delivers a CPU32 core operating at 25 MHz. Packaged in a compact 160-pin QFP with a 28 mm × 28 mm body, this ROMless microcontroller offers flexibility for custom firmware development and advanced system integration. Although now classified as obsolete, the MC68376BGCAB25 remains relevant within legacy industrial, automotive, and automation systems due to its rich peripheral set, robust architecture, and proven reliability.
At the heart of the MC68376BGCAB25 lies the CPU32 core, delivering 32-bit processing with a single-core architecture running at 25 MHz. This positions it well for real-time computation, control-loop tasks, and signal processing. The device operates from a single supply voltage in the range of 4.75 V to 5.25 V, supporting stable performance in noisy industrial environments.
The MC68376BGCAB25 is designed without internal ROM, offering maximum flexibility for external program memory choices or reprogrammable flash and EEPROM solutions. Embedded within are 7.5K × 8 bytes of RAM, sufficient for stack, variable storage, and buffering applications. The absence of on-chip program ROM encourages engineers to tailor memory architecture to precise application requirements, a feature valued in applications with unique firmware or secure code update needs.
The MC68376BGCAB25’s functional diversity is a highlight of the M683xx platform. Integrated peripherals include advanced connectivity and control modules such as:
CANbus (Controller Area Network), making the MC68376BGCAB25 highly suitable for automotive and distributed industrial control;
Enhanced Bus Interface (EBI/EMI) for flexible, high-throughput external memory and I/O expansion;
Synchronous Serial Interface (SCI), and SPI for general serial communication requirements;
On-chip A/D converter (16 channels, 10-bit), supporting multi-channel analog input for sensor and monitoring systems;
Dedicated motor control and timing peripherals, with on-chip Pulse Width Modulation (PWM), Watchdog Timer (WDT), and various timer channels to support precision timing and control tasks.
This comprehensive set of peripherals makes the MC68376BGCAB25 a strong candidate for applications demanding a tight integration of signal acquisition, control, and communication, such as in automotive ECUs, automation controllers, and advanced instrumentation.
System designers evaluating the MC68376BGCAB25 will note its robust electrical performance in a standard 5 V logic environment. The microcontroller's recommended operating voltage range is 4.75 V to 5.25 V, with on-chip RAM of 7.5K × 8 bytes. Its operating junction temperature range is -40°C to +85°C, making it suitable for deployment in a wide range of industrial and automotive environments.
The device also supports various critical power-on reset (POR) and standby management features, ensuring reliable startup and system safety during brownout or power anomaly scenarios. When designing with the MC68376BGCAB25, power dissipation, noise immunity, and careful PCB grounding/layout are essential, given the device’s integration level and analog-digital functional mix.
The MC68376BGCAB25 is available exclusively in a 160-pin surface-mount QFP (Quad Flat Package), with package dimensions detailed as follows: 28.0 mm × 28.0 mm body, and height between 3.35 mm and 3.85 mm. Lead pitch is standardized at 0.65 mm, supporting high-density PCB design while allowing for manufacturability and inspection.
The robust QFP package supports secure attachment and reliable thermal performance under a wide range of operating conditions. Engineers should note the MSL (Moisture Sensitivity Level) classification is 3 (168 hours floor life), and adhere to best practices for package handling, soldering, and storage in volume manufacturing.

Given the MC68376BGCAB25’s status as an obsolete device, engineering teams maintaining or refurbishing legacy platforms should consider potential equivalent or replacement options. The closest direct alternatives within NXP’s product lineup include other M683xx series microcontrollers such as the MC68336 family, which share architectural compatibility, package formats, and peripheral sets.
When selecting an alternative, review the pinout, peripheral integrations, operating frequency, and memory architecture. For new designs or significant redesigns, transitioning to NXP’s current-generation automotive or industrial microcontroller platforms (e.g., MPC56xx or S32 series) might be appropriate, though this typically involves more extensive system and software migration.
